Transaction 7869ee5910f151c1356251e1ee637660167e55a78e9c6b1a323d6c2092eb4011
2 Input
2 Outputs
- 7869ee5910f151c1356251e1ee637660167e55a78e9c6b1a323d6c2092eb4011:0
- 7869ee5910f151c1356251e1ee637660167e55a78e9c6b1a323d6c2092eb4011:1
value 99976881
address 1P6Way9sGRRMtXy6zemKqjCUhbBAaXZSxW
value 400000000
address 12fdRUQy4iXMoYvhnk7MCzzBLr2JikYauN